The Tourism Authority of Thailand (TAT) is actively advancing its Sub-Culture Economy strategy through a special collaboration with Siam Amazing Park and Blissoo, launching "CLICK at Siam Amazing Park." This initiative transforms the actual filming locations from "CLICK," the latest music video by South Korean singer, actress, and BLACKPINK member JISOO, into a limited-time Bangkok travel experience available until November 15, 2026.
Mr. Chuwit Sirivajjakul, TAT Deputy Governor for Policy and Planning, stated that passions, communities, and cultural influence are driving the future of tourism. Through the Sub-Culture Economy, TAT is creating new pathways to inspire travel to Thailand, deepen engagement with destinations, and generate higher tourism value by leveraging creative content to attract interest-led travellers worldwide.
Released on September 4, 2026, "CLICK" explores the connection between JISOO and her global fan community through a new character named CLICK Bear. With key scenes filmed on location at Siam Amazing Park, the music video serves as a creative foundation that allows visitors to directly engage with its settings, imagery, and pop culture fandom in a real-world environment.

The immersive experience unfolds across six themed check-in points. Guests begin their journey at Si-Am Amazing Hall to receive a CLICK Passport for stamp collection and photo opportunities with a four-metre CLICK Bear. This is followed by CLICK Message & CLICK Post, where fans can submit messages to JISOO via a special "JISOO 10230" postal service. Additional stops include CLICK Moment, which recreates the rollercoaster setting featuring the actual seat JISOO used during filming, and a double-decker carousel before concluding at Si-Am Amazing Shop for food, beverages, and limited-edition merchandise.
The Sub-Culture Economy framework represents a modern tourism strategy designed to capture high-spending, highly engaged communities such as global K-Pop fandoms. By converting international pop music video locations into tangible local attractions, TAT bridges creative content with real-world travel, positioning Bangkok as a premier destination where global entertainment culture and tourism intersect.
Created in partnership with Thailand Post, the "JISOO 10230 THAILAND" initiative further expands the experience by enabling fans worldwide to send letters and messages to JISOO throughout the campaign. Participants who fill their CLICK Passport with the required stamps can also redeem them for a special-edition JISOO postcard.
Three participation packages are currently available: CLICK Adventure Pass, Super CLICK Adventure Pass, and Annual CLICK Collectable Pass. Each option includes all-day access to Siam Amazing Park's water and amusement parks, alongside a CLICK Passport and selected merchandise items based on package terms.
